What’s the Buzz About Zootopia 2?

Released in 2016, Zootopia wowed audiences with its rich storytelling and compelling characters. It followed the journey of Judy Hopps, a rabbit police officer, and Nick Wilde, a cunning fox, as they navigated the complexities of a city where various animal species coexist. With a powerful message about tolerance, acceptance, and understanding, it was only a matter of time before Disney announced a sequel.

Zootopia 2 aims to build upon the original’s themes while introducing new characters and plotlines. But in typical Disney fashion, fans have begun to scrutinize every scene and frame for hidden gems. This is where the Easter egg linking to a real-world event comes into play.

The Role of Easter Eggs in Animation

Easter eggs have become a staple in the world of animated films, particularly from studios like Disney and Pixar. They serve various purposes, including:

  • Connecting Franchises: Easter eggs often link different films within the same universe, creating a cohesive storytelling experience.
  • Encouraging Rewatching: Fans love to search for hidden details, prompting them to watch the movie multiple times.
  • Maintaining Engagement: Easter eggs keep fans talking and engaged long after a film’s release.
